American MotoGP Riders: Mental Toughness – The Key to Success

The roar of the crowd, the screech of tires, the sheer speed – MotoGP is a brutal sport, demanding not only physical prowess but also incredible mental fortitude. While American riders haven't consistently dominated the MotoGP world championship like some European nations, the mental game plays a crucial role in their successes and failures. Let's delve into the mental toughness required for American riders to compete at the highest level of motorcycle racing.

The Pressure Cooker: Mental Demands of MotoGP

MotoGP isn't just about speed; it's about precision, strategy, and unwavering focus under immense pressure. American riders face unique challenges:

1. The Weight of Expectation:

Unlike some European riders who may rise through national series before hitting the global stage, the pressure on American riders to perform at the highest level internationally can be immense. The expectations from sponsors, fans, and even themselves can be overwhelming. Managing this pressure is a critical mental skill.

2. Competition from Global Powerhouses:

The MotoGP grid is incredibly competitive, dominated by riders from Italy, Spain, and other European countries with rich racing histories. American riders constantly face top-tier competition, demanding exceptional resilience and belief in their abilities to overcome setbacks and stay motivated.

3. High-Risk, High-Reward Environment:

MotoGP is inherently dangerous. Accidents happen, and injuries can be severe. Maintaining focus and composure despite the inherent risks requires exceptional mental strength. American riders need to manage fear, bounce back from crashes, and learn from mistakes without letting it affect their confidence.

Mental Strategies: Cultivating Inner Strength

Successful American MotoGP riders often demonstrate specific mental strategies:

1. Visualization and Mental Rehearsal:

Top riders regularly visualize successful races, practicing race scenarios in their minds. This technique helps them anticipate challenges, develop strategies, and build confidence. It's a critical element of mental preparation for the intense demands of MotoGP.

2. Mindfulness and Stress Management:

The high-pressure environment requires effective stress management techniques. Mindfulness practices, such as meditation and controlled breathing, can help American riders stay grounded, focused, and composed amidst the chaos of a race.

3. Goal Setting and Self-Belief:

Clear and achievable goals are crucial. Setting realistic targets and fostering a strong belief in their capabilities fuels their motivation and drives them forward, even during difficult periods. A strong sense of self-efficacy is crucial for success.
